Nicholas Cage appeared quite different as he was seen in a fat suit while filming the upcoming sports biopic, *Madden*. The actor, who is taking on the role of former Oakland Raiders head coach John Madden, was spotted on Monday in Atlanta, dressed in a blue tracksuit with white sneakers and sporting long hair.

Cage, 61, is acting alongside John Mulany and businessman and Electronic Arts founder Travel Hawkins, with Christian Bale portraying Al Davis, the long-time owner of the Raiders.

However, the production has faced some challenges. Reports indicate that one actor left the project after director David O. Russell allegedly used a racial slur during rehearsals. According to TMZ, this actor departed just two weeks into filming.

Sources revealed that several cast members claimed Russell, 66, made the offensive remark while working on a monologue. Insiders from Amazon Studios suggested that the use of the slur in the script originated from the actor’s idea, but that the screenwriter also employed the term outside of filming. It seems the departure was partly influenced by a nude scene in the script as well.

Additionally, Cage had expressed discomfort to Russell regarding a locker room scene where he was required to be nude. Reportedly, the director’s response was seen as “unprofessional.” Although an intimacy coordinator tried to assist, Cage still felt uneasy. Allegedly, Russell ended up telling Cage that he didn’t need him on set any longer.

Despite the tensions, there were hints that discussions might allow for the actor’s return to the film. Meanwhile, Russell has not commented on these events. The director has a history of controversies; for instance, George Clooney previously recounted an incident from the set of the 1999 film *Three Kings*, depicting Russell in a difficult light.
